react-diff-viewer vs react-diff-view
Confronto dei pacchetti npm di "Librerie per la visualizzazione delle differenze in React"
1 Anno
react-diff-viewerreact-diff-viewPacchetti simili:
Cos'è Librerie per la visualizzazione delle differenze in React?

Le librerie 'react-diff-view' e 'react-diff-viewer' sono strumenti utili per visualizzare le differenze tra due versioni di un testo o di un codice all'interno di applicazioni React. Queste librerie consentono agli sviluppatori di evidenziare le modifiche apportate, facilitando la revisione del codice e il confronto dei contenuti. Entrambe le librerie offrono funzionalità per il rendering delle differenze in modo chiaro e comprensibile, ma differiscono nelle loro implementazioni e nelle opzioni di personalizzazione.

Trend di download npm
Classifica GitHub Stars
Dettaglio statistiche
Pacchetto
Download
Stars
Dimensione
Issues
Pubblicazione
Licenza
react-diff-viewer177,3681,559-84il y a 5 ansMIT
react-diff-view78,7159301.3 MB6il y a 7 moisMIT
Confronto funzionalità: react-diff-viewer vs react-diff-view

Personalizzazione

  • react-diff-viewer:

    'react-diff-viewer' fornisce opzioni di personalizzazione più limitate rispetto a 'react-diff-view'. Tuttavia, è progettata per essere semplice da usare e integrare, offrendo un'interfaccia utente pulita e chiara senza la necessità di molte configurazioni.

  • react-diff-view:

    'react-diff-view' offre un'ampia gamma di opzioni di personalizzazione, consentendo agli sviluppatori di modificare il layout, i colori e gli stili delle differenze visualizzate. Puoi facilmente adattare la libreria alle esigenze specifiche del tuo progetto, rendendola molto flessibile per vari scenari d'uso.

Facilità d'uso

  • react-diff-viewer:

    'react-diff-viewer' è molto facile da usare e richiede pochissimo tempo per essere configurata. È ideale per gli sviluppatori che desiderano implementare rapidamente una visualizzazione delle differenze senza doversi preoccupare di dettagli complessi.

  • react-diff-view:

    Nonostante la sua flessibilità, 'react-diff-view' può richiedere un po' più di tempo per essere configurata correttamente, specialmente per gli sviluppatori meno esperti. La curva di apprendimento può essere più ripida a causa delle numerose opzioni disponibili.

Prestazioni

  • react-diff-viewer:

    'react-diff-viewer' è progettata per essere leggera e performante, rendendola adatta per applicazioni che richiedono una visualizzazione rapida delle differenze senza compromettere le prestazioni.

  • react-diff-view:

    'react-diff-view' è ottimizzata per gestire grandi quantità di dati e differenze complesse. Tuttavia, la personalizzazione eccessiva può influire sulle prestazioni, quindi è importante bilanciare la flessibilità con l'efficienza.

Supporto e Manutenzione

  • react-diff-viewer:

    'react-diff-viewer' tende ad avere una comunità più attiva e un supporto più robusto, il che può facilitare la risoluzione dei problemi e l'adozione di nuove funzionalità.

  • react-diff-view:

    Essendo una libreria più complessa, 'react-diff-view' può richiedere una maggiore attenzione per la manutenzione e gli aggiornamenti. È importante seguire le versioni e le modifiche per garantire la compatibilità con le nuove versioni di React.

Scenari d'uso

  • react-diff-viewer:

    Perfetta per applicazioni che necessitano di una visualizzazione semplice e immediata delle differenze, come strumenti di gestione dei contenuti o applicazioni di documentazione. È adatta per scenari in cui la rapidità di implementazione è una priorità.

  • react-diff-view:

    Ideale per applicazioni che richiedono un confronto dettagliato e personalizzato delle differenze, come editor di codice o strumenti di revisione. È particolarmente utile in contesti in cui le differenze devono essere presentate in modo altamente visivo e interattivo.

Come scegliere: react-diff-viewer vs react-diff-view
  • react-diff-viewer:

    Scegli 'react-diff-viewer' se desideri una soluzione pronta all'uso con una configurazione minima. È più semplice da integrare e offre una visualizzazione delle differenze chiara e intuitiva, rendendola adatta per applicazioni che necessitano di una rapida implementazione senza molte personalizzazioni.

  • react-diff-view:

    Scegli 'react-diff-view' se hai bisogno di una libreria altamente personalizzabile che ti consenta di controllare dettagliatamente la visualizzazione delle differenze. È ideale per progetti che richiedono una visualizzazione complessa delle differenze e una maggiore flessibilità nella personalizzazione del layout e dello stile.